Flames hoping to tune up on July 6

Football Association of Malawi (FAM) has said it is keeping its fingers crossed that government will include an international friendly should there be activities to mark the country’s 50th Anniversary of Independence Celebrations on July 6.

FAM chief executive officer Suzgo Nyirenda said the match would be the opportunity for the Flames to prepare for their 2015 Africa Cup of Nations final preliminary round, first leg against Benin.

“As at now, we have no money to cater for Flames preparations and there is no Fifa calendar date between now and the time we face Benin,” said Nyirenda.

But he said they are yet to get communication from Sports Council on this year’s July 6 celebrations.

Council executive secretary George Jana said they were also yet to get communication from government on the same.
